Police Operatives Identify Refuge of Abductors of UniAbuja Professors 

Police Operatives Identify Refuge of Abductors of UniAbuja Professors

 Police operatives in Abuja reported that they have identified the unknown gunmen that attacked the University of Abuja and abduct lecturers during the week. Information Guide Nigeria

Sunday Babaji, the FCT Police Commissioner said this through the FCT Police Public Relations Officer Josephine Adeh, adding that the Police discovered the criminals’ hideout and freed all the abducted persons.

According to ICIR, in Adeh’s words: “Following investigations and the manhunt for the criminal elements involved in the abduction of staff of the University of Abuja at the University Staff Quarters, Giri, on 2nd November 2021, Operatives of the Nigeria Police Force in collaboration with the Military, the DSS and other security agencies in a joint operation, the early hours of Friday 5th November 2021, successfully identified the hideout of the criminals located at Shenegwu Forest in the Gwagwalada area of the FCT and rescued all abducted victims unhurt.”

“The criminal elements on sighting the security team engaged them in a fierce gun duel. However, the superior firepower of the security operatives led to the arrest of eight (8) members of the notorious gang while some other members of the gang fled into the forest and nearby communities”. jamb results

Babaji advised residents in Abuja, especially those around the Gwagwalada area of the FCT, to be alert and provide the Police with good information that could help in fighting the gang members.

The Police said all the suspects arrested would soon be charged to court after due investigations.
